Summary: A description of Finnish morphology written for libvoikko
Voikko-fi is a description of Finnish morphology written for libvoikko.
The implementation uses unweighted VFST format and provides format 5 Finnish
dictionary for libvoikko 4.0 or later. For Voikko the morphology supports
spell checking, hyphenation and grammar checking.
